Gloat, an inside market for company expertise, at the moment introduced that it raised $90 million in a Collection D spherical led by Era Funding Administration, bringing the startup’s whole raised to $192 million. Era, notably, is chaired by former U.S. Vice President Al Gore. In an electronic mail Q&A with Nob6, CEO Ben Reuveni mentioned that the proceeds will likely be put towards increasing Gloat’s presence, rising its workforce of over 250 staff and “strengthening” its R&D initiatives.

The listing of worker recruitment, acquisition and jobs boards merchandise is virtually countless — see Workday, LinkedIn and SAP SuccessFactors to begin. Reuveni doesn’t deny that Gloat faces stiff competitors, however he sums up what he believes to be the corporate’s differentiators thusly: “Gloat is exclusive in that we began by powering an answer for inside mobility. Throughout the market, there are a variety of recruiting … instruments to supply exterior candidates, however inside mobility poses distinctive and nuanced challenges. It requires an actual understanding of transferable abilities and titles that will not be apparent with out the deep, organization- and industry-specific perception Gloat’s know-how was constructed to supply.”

Reuveni based Gloat in 2015 alongside Amichai Schreiber and Danny Shteinberg. Reuveni was beforehand a options architect at IBM, whereas Schreiber got here from Intel, Mobileye (previous to Intel’s acquisition) and HP.

As my colleague Ingrid Lunden reported final yr, Gloat sells an AI-powered platform to organizations to energy their job boards. Built-in with present software program, Gloat sources info on staff to assist match them to job openings at their employer — whether or not they’re proactively looking or a supervisor seeks them out. In instances the place a employee falls wanting necessities, the platform supplies steering on what they should study in addition to part-time and shadowing alternatives.

Gloat makes use of an AI system to map the relationships between abilities, roles, candidates and firms. Skilled on CVs, skilled profiles, job descriptions, tutorial content material, financial information and compensation information, the system makes an attempt to quantify the ways in which job titles, job necessities and ability wants change, Reuveni mentioned. Given the identical job title can imply various things relying on the corporate; Gloat was designed to grasp these nuances and robotically infer variations in roles throughout corporations, geographies and industries.

“Utilizing Gloat’s AI, each worker will get customized profession path choices primarily based on their distinctive abilities and pursuits. And as job-specific necessities evolve and new roles emerge in a company, the AI identifies these modifications and adjusts its suggestions accordingly,” Reuveni mentioned.

Gloat additionally captures the “aspirations” of staff, Reuveni says, knowledgeable by the talents they use most often and their skilled growth plans. Within the best-case situation, assuming Gloat’s information is correct, this might present a useful resource to administration as they determine find out how to deploy expertise.

After all, no algorithm is unbiased. And in hiring, the influence will be extreme. LinkedIn years in the past found that the advice algorithms it makes use of to match job candidates with alternatives had been referring extra males than girls for open roles. The algorithm ranked candidates partly on the premise of how probably they had been to use for a place or reply to a recruiter, and — as MIT Know-how Evaluation notes in its report on the bug — males are sometimes extra aggressive at in search of out new alternatives.

A weblog post penned by Gloat HR analyst Adam Etzion dated February 2021 discusses an “anti-biased dataset” utilized by Gloat’s information science workforce, customizable to particular person prospects. And a whitepaper, printed final April, particulars Gloat’s bias detection instruments that may decide up on undesirable developments in AI-powered suggestions and introduce noise into the info to (in idea) mitigate them.

Hyperbolic as that may sound, Gloat’s buyer listing is expansive and consists of manufacturers like Mastercard, Unilever, Schneider Electrical, Nestlé, Novartis, Normal Chartered Financial institution and HSBC. Greater than 1.1 million customers in over 120 nations use the platform, Reuveni mentioned, a quantity that’s grown through the pandemic as corporations’ hiring decelerated and the main target turned towards upskilling their workforce.

Gloat can also be benefitting from a basic rise in VC funding for HR tech startups. In January, VCs funneled greater than $1.4 billion into HR tech, in accordance with PitchBook data, constructing on a file yr — 2021 — that noticed over $12.3 in enterprise capital invested in HR tech throughout greater than 800 offers.

Accel, Eight Roads Ventures, Intel Capital and Lumir Ventures additionally participated in New York-based Gloat’s newest funding spherical. Reuveni famous that it marks Era’s first funding out of its new $1.7 billion Sustainable Options Fund IV, which goals to spend money on corporations and groups driving “accountable innovation.”
